Bob

Bob spent a fabulous career as a successful artist painting and drawing for department stores advertising where his work caught the attention of many celebrities. After discovering that his partner was stealing from him, undergoing a necessary heart surgery and facing many other adversities, Bob began to recluse in his house, buying antiques to fill up his 7,000 square foot Victorian Mansion. Bob's dream of restoring his home is now the priority of getting his life back on track but the house needs structural restoration, or the entire building might collapse. With the help of the Hoarders team of experts, Bob can hopefully make his mansion one of St. Louis' top five homes again.
